1. PayPal: PayPal has been the leader in merchant services for years, and they remain one of the most popular choices in 2023. Their payment gateway is secure, reliable and easy to use. The company also offers fraud protection, invoicing features, customer support, and more.

 

  1. Stripe: Stripe is another popular e-commerce merchant service provider. They offer secure payment processing, easy setup, and reliable customer support. Stripe also features fraud protection services, user analytics tools, and the ability to accept payments from all major credit cards.

 

  1. Square: Square is a great option for smaller businesses that don’t require the full suite of features offered by larger merchant service providers. They offer simple setup, secure payment processing, and fast customer support.

 

  1. Amazon Payments: For businesses that rely heavily on Amazon for sales, Amazon Payments is a great option. You can accept payments from customers through their mobile app or website, and you can also take advantage of their fraud protection services.

 

  1. Braintree: Braintree is an all-in-one merchant service provider that offers everything from payment processing to fraud protection services. They also provide an extensive API for developers. This makes it easier and faster for businesses to integrate their e-commerce stores with their merchant accounts.

 

  1. Authorize.net: Authorize.net is another reliable merchant service provider that offers a secure payment gateway, fraud protection services and invoicing features. They also provide a range of tools to help businesses manage their accounts and customers.

 

  1. Intuit QuickBooks Payments: QuickBooks Payments is one of the leaders in merchant services for small-to-medium businesses. Their payment gateway is secure and easy to use, they offer powerful invoicing features and fraud protection services, plus they’re integrated with QuickBooks software.

 

  1. 2Checkout: 2Checkout is another popular merchant service provider that offers a secure payment gateway, fraud protection services, user analytics tools, and more. They have an extensive library of integrations that make it easy for businesses to connect their e-commerce stores with their merchant accounts.

 

  1. Skrill: Skrill is a comprehensive merchant service provider that offers payment processing, fraud protection services and more. They also offer online invoicing tools and the ability to accept payments from customers in over 200 countries.

 

  1. Sage Pay: Sage Pay is a merchant service provider that specializes in providing secure payment solutions for businesses of all sizes. They offer fraud protection services, support for multiple currencies and the ability to accept payments from major credit cards.

 

  1. Worldpay: Worldpay is another reliable merchant service provider that provides payment processing, fraud protection services and more. They offer a wide range of integrations and the ability to accept payments from customers in over 150 countries.

 

  1. PayU: PayU is an international merchant service provider that specializes in providing secure payment solutions for businesses around the world. They offer fraud protection services, support for multiple currencies and the ability to accept payments from major credit  cards. They also have an extensive library of integrations for businesses to connect their e-commerce stores with their merchant accounts.

These  are just a few of the many e-commerce merchant service providers available. Each one offers different features, so it’s important to research each option carefully before making a decision. Consider what services you need, how much you’re willing to spend, and any other factors that will help you pick the best provider for your business.
